Output 4938700a85f9941248982f680b9ea717a17f7596effb1ea001496758c13b7a89:1

value
175989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754d507549f05cb8a7188ff8984396bb8d53ee66 OP_EQUAL
address
3CPFbsvzarFkbP6xe5R5N2yhE8kV66SZPy
transaction
4938700a85f9941248982f680b9ea717a17f7596effb1ea001496758c13b7a89
spent
true